Choosing the Right Compression Settings for Earthquake Footage

While Klipa AI’s default settings work great, understanding the nuts and bolts helps you make informed trade-offs. The two main levers are resolution and bitrate. Resolution is the pixel dimensions (e.g., 1920×1080 for Full HD); bitrate is the amount of data per second of video. Higher bitrate means more detail but larger files. For earthquake videos shared on social media, 720p at 2–4 Mbps is often more than enough. The shaking motion and fine cracks in walls remain visible without the file size ballooning.

Format matters too. MP4 with H.264 codec is the universal standard for compatibility. If your earthquake video came off a DSLR in MOV format, consider using the video converter to transcode it to MP4 first—this alone can sometimes reduce file size because modern MP4 codecs are more efficient. Klipa’s compressor outputs MP4 by default, so you’re set no matter what you start with.

Common Mistakes When Compressing Earthquake Videos (And How to Avoid Them)

Over-compression is enemy number one. Cranking the compression slider to minimum file size might seem tempting, but you’ll end up with a blocky, unwatchable mess. The fine details that make earthquake footage compelling—cracked walls, falling objects, subtle ground tremors—can get smeared into oblivion. Always preview your compressed video before sharing. Klipa AI’s side-by-side preview makes it easy to compare original and compressed versions, so you can dial in the right balance.

Another pitfall is compressing an already compressed video. If you’ve compressed once, downloading, and then re-compressing, you introduce generation loss—digital artifacts that pile up and degrade the image permanently. Start from the original file whenever possible. Also, avoid compressing to the wrong format. While MP4 is king, some niche platforms or devices might require MOV or WebM. Use the video converter to switch formats after compression if needed, rather than trying to compress directly into a less compatible container.
